Dividir php em páginas diferentes
boa tarde pessoal, gostaria de saber se existe forma de dividir uma página em php em várias páginas php, para utilizar apenas partes especificas dela em aplicações diferentes, por exemplo
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{
if(isset($_POST['queryString'])) {
$queryString = $db->real_escape_string($_POST['queryString']);
if(strlen($queryString) > 0) {
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E '$queryString%' LIMIT 1");
if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.htmlentities($result->escola).'\'); getfocusendereco();">' .htmlentities ($result->escola).''; }
} else {
echo 'erro na query!'; }
} else {}
} else {
echo 'não abra o script diretamente!';}}?>
eu queria repartir ele em 3 partes para poder utilizar em lugares diferentes.
grato desde já
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{
if(isset($_POST['queryString'])) {
$queryString = $db->real_escape_string($_POST['queryString']);
if(strlen($queryString) > 0) {
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E '$queryString%' LIMIT 1");
if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.htmlentities($result->escola).'\'); getfocusendereco();">' .htmlentities ($result->escola).''; }
} else {
echo 'erro na query!'; }
} else {}
} else {
echo 'não abra o script diretamente!';}}?>
eu queria repartir ele em 3 partes para poder utilizar em lugares diferentes.
grato desde já
Data | Autor | Changelog | Download |
---|---|---|---|
18/09/2013 2:07pm | fye flourigh | - | Versão 1.0 |
usar o include
06/03/2014 10:06am
(~10 anos atrás)
@jose fernando betezek; entendi, ou seja, melhor não separar? ou é possivel?
obrigado a todos
obrigado a todos
04/10/2013 11:28am
(~11 anos atrás)
Tente colocar toda string em todas as páginas, porque o mysql deve ser um conjunto e não pode ser quebrado se não perde as funções....
$$
$$
01/10/2013 8:33am
(~11 anos atrás)
um dos includes seria nesta parte
if(strlen($queryString) > 0) {
<!-- separa -->
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E
<!-- separa -->
'$queryString%' LIMIT 1");
if(strlen($queryString) > 0) {
<!-- separa -->
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E
<!-- separa -->
'$queryString%' LIMIT 1");
28/09/2013 6:26pm
(~11 anos atrás)
assim, vou tentar melhor, este código acima, funciona perfetamente quando na mesma página, mas eu tenho 3 páginas com o mesmo código que muda apenas 3 linhas, eu queria colocar o código em 1 página apenas e em 3 página, buscar apenas a linha que muda, mas quando ponho include, da erro de código fechado incorretamente, pois eu dividi o código de modo errado, ou seja,
ou seja, quando eu separo e ponho include, o código não feicha.
ou seja, quando eu separo e ponho include, o código não feicha.
28/09/2013 6:24pm
(~11 anos atrás)
olha, cada página tem que ser uma página separada... tipo assim:
conect.php
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{
?>
outronome.php
e assim por diante.
aí sim vc chama pelo require_once ou pelo include.
Vá testando...
conect.php
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{
?>
outronome.php
e assim por diante.
aí sim vc chama pelo require_once ou pelo include.
Vá testando...
27/09/2013 11:05am
(~11 anos atrás)
seria mais ou menos isso, tenho o código acima, quero dividir assim
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{?>
<!-- include -->
<?php if(isset($_POST['queryString'])) {
$queryString = $db->real_escape_string($_POST['queryString']); ?>
<!-- include -->
<?php if(strlen($queryString) > 0) {
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E '$queryString%' LIMIT 1"); ?>
<!-- include -->
<?php if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.htmlentities($result->escola).'\'); getfocusendereco();">' .htmlentities ($result->escola).''; }?>
<!-- include -->
<?php } else {
echo 'erro na query!'; }
} else {}
} else {
echo 'não abra o script diretamente!';}}?>
eu colocaria uma parte em cada arquivo e chamaria em include
ps: grato pela resposta
<?php $db = new mysqli('host', 'user' ,'senha', 'bd');
if(!$db) {
echo 'ERROR: Could not connect to the database.';
} else {?>
<!-- include -->
<?php if(isset($_POST['queryString'])) {
$queryString = $db->real_escape_string($_POST['queryString']); ?>
<!-- include -->
<?php if(strlen($queryString) > 0) {
$query = $db->query("SELECT escola FROM escola WHERE escola LIKE '$queryString%' LIMIT 1"); ?>
<!-- include -->
<?php if($query) {
while ($result = $query ->fetch_object()) {
echo '<li onClick="fill(\''.htmlentities($result->escola).'\'); getfocusendereco();">' .htmlentities ($result->escola).''; }?>
<!-- include -->
<?php } else {
echo 'erro na query!'; }
} else {}
} else {
echo 'não abra o script diretamente!';}}?>
eu colocaria uma parte em cada arquivo e chamaria em include
ps: grato pela resposta
27/09/2013 9:25am
(~11 anos atrás)
Explique melhor!!!
Veja, acho que seja mais ou menos isso que queira:
crie as páginas diferentes e depois faça um include delas onde necessita... ou um require ... não está bem feita sua pergunta!
abraços.
Veja, acho que seja mais ou menos isso que queira:
crie as páginas diferentes e depois faça um include delas onde necessita... ou um require ... não está bem feita sua pergunta!
abraços.
27/09/2013 9:16am
(~11 anos atrás)